I've read a little about this. I think that Wheeler had just returned to the army in Alabama from his August/September raid into Tennessee. I don't know if Hannon was with Wheeler in his raid. During that raid, I think that Gen. Jackson's division was the only cavalry with Hood's army. Wheeler reassumed command of the army's cavalry to perform rear guard duty, while Hood was at Gadsden and Sherman at Gaylesville. When Hood marched north, he took Jackson, leaving Wheeler to stay in front of Sherman, even when he turned about and marched east. There were several battles between Wheeler's cavalry and Sherman's infantry in that area during the month Sherman waited while Hood moved to and camped at Tuscumbia/Florence.
